Strategies for Responsible Gaming
To foster a healthy gaming environment, we should implement practical strategies that encourage balance and responsibility.
Prioritizing accessibility can create a gaming culture where everyone feels welcome and supported. This involves:
- Ensuring that games are designed with diverse needs in mind.
- Offering various difficulty levels.
- Providing resources for those seeking help.
Our collective well-being should be at the forefront of our gaming experiences. To maintain a healthy relationship with gaming, consider the following:
- Set time limits.
- Take regular breaks.
- Form groups or communities that promote open discussions about responsible gaming habits.
